Why These Are the Top GMC Repair Auto Repair Shops in Bakersfield

The GMC repair market serving Bakersfield, VT, is characteristic of a rural region. There are no dedicated GMC or GM dealerships immediately within the town. The market consists of a few highly trusted, multi-generational local garages and a couple of reputable dealership service departments in nearby larger towns like St. Albans and Swanton. **Average Quality:** The quality of service is generally high, with shops competing on reputation and trustworthiness rather than marketing. The best providers have mechanics with decades of experience specifically with American-made trucks. **Competition Level:** Competition is moderate. While there aren't dozens of shops, the existing providers are established and have loyal customer bases. This means they are not competing on price alone but on demonstrated expertise and reliability, particularly for complex jobs like Duramax or Allison repairs. **Typical Pricing:** Labor rates are typically lower than in major urban centers, ranging from **$100 - $140 per hour**. However, for specialized diesel or transmission work, rates can be at the higher end of that scale. Parts pricing is consistent with national averages, though OEM parts may involve a short wait time for delivery to this rural location. Overall, consumers receive strong value for money, paying for expertise without metropolitan-area overhead costs.

What are the most common GMC repair issues for vehicles in the Bakersfield, VT area?

Given Bakersfield's rural roads and harsh winters, common issues for GMC trucks and SUVs include four-wheel-drive system maintenance, brake wear from road salt and grit, and suspension component stress from uneven terrain. Local shops also frequently address check engine lights related to cold-weather starting and emissions systems.

When should I seek local service for my GMC's four-wheel-drive system?

You should have the 4WD system serviced before winter, especially if you use your GMC for navigating unpaved Bakersfield roads or snow-covered driveways. Any unusual noises, difficulty engaging modes, or warning lights related to the transfer case or differentials warrant an immediate check at a local specialist.

What local considerations should I keep in mind for GMC maintenance in Bakersfield?

Prioritize undercarriage washes to combat rust from winter road salt and ensure your cooling system is prepared for both summer heat and freezing temperatures. Given the distance to larger dealerships, building a relationship with a trusted local independent shop for routine maintenance can lead to faster service and reliable advice for your specific driving conditions.
